The MCH blood test measures the average amount of hemoglobin in each red blood cell and is usually reported as part of a complete blood count. It can help doctors look for patterns such as anemia, vitamin deficiency, or other blood-related conditions, but it is best interpreted together with the rest of the blood count and the person’s symptoms.
Overview
The MCH blood test is one of those laboratory numbers that often appears on a report before a patient has had time to ask what it means. MCH stands for mean corpuscular hemoglobin, and it describes the average amount of hemoglobin inside a single red blood cell. Hemoglobin is the protein that carries oxygen through the body, so MCH is part of the larger picture of how well red blood cells are doing their job.
Doctors rarely interpret MCH on its own. It is usually included in a complete blood count, also called a CBC, and read alongside related measures such as hemoglobin, hematocrit, MCV, and MCHC. In practice, that means the number is less like a standalone diagnosis and more like a clue that helps a clinician understand whether the red blood cells are normal, underfilled with hemoglobin, or carrying more hemoglobin than expected.

What the MCH result can show

MCH is expressed as a small numerical value and tells the laboratory how much hemoglobin, on average, is present in each red blood cell. When the value falls outside the reference range used by the lab, it suggests the red blood cells may be carrying less or more hemoglobin than expected. That does not automatically mean something serious is happening, but it does prompt a closer look.
A low MCH often appears when red blood cells contain less hemoglobin than usual. This pattern can be seen with iron deficiency and some types of anemia. A high MCH may appear when red blood cells are larger than usual, which can happen with vitamin B12 deficiency, folate deficiency, or other conditions that affect red blood cell production.
It is helpful to think of MCH as one piece of a broader puzzle. A person may feel well and have a slightly unusual MCH because of a temporary or mild factor, while another person with symptoms such as fatigue, dizziness, or shortness of breath may need a more detailed evaluation even if only one value is abnormal.
- Low MCH: suggests red blood cells may carry less hemoglobin
- High MCH: suggests red blood cells may carry more hemoglobin, often because they are larger
- Normal MCH: does not rule out every blood problem, especially early-stage issues
Symptoms that may prompt testing

The MCH value itself does not cause symptoms. Instead, doctors order or review this test when they want to understand symptoms that could be related to anemia or another blood condition. Fatigue is one of the most common reasons, especially when it is persistent or not explained by poor sleep, stress, or recent illness.
Other symptoms can include pale skin, dizziness, shortness of breath during routine activity, headaches, cold hands and feet, fast heartbeat, or reduced exercise tolerance. In some cases, there are no obvious symptoms at all, and the blood test is done during a routine checkup, a pre-operative assessment, or a broader workup for another condition.
Symptoms are especially important when they travel with a recent change in diet, heavy menstrual bleeding, gastrointestinal symptoms, weight loss, or a history of chronic disease. Causes and risk factors
Several common situations can influence MCH. Iron deficiency is among the best-known causes of a low MCH because the body needs iron to build hemoglobin. Blood loss, including heavy periods or slow blood loss from the digestive tract, can also contribute. In children and adults alike, a diet low in iron or problems absorbing iron can play a role.
High MCH is often linked to conditions that make red blood cells larger than normal. Vitamin B12 deficiency and folate deficiency are frequent examples. Other causes can include certain medications, alcohol use, liver disease, and some bone marrow disorders. A doctor will also consider whether the result fits with the person’s age, medical history, and other CBC values.
Risk factors differ depending on the underlying cause. People with restrictive diets, digestive disorders, pregnancy, heavy menstrual bleeding, chronic inflammation, or a known family history of blood disorders may be more likely to show abnormalities. That said, an unusual MCH can also appear without an obvious risk factor, which is why the next step is usually a thoughtful review rather than immediate concern.
How the diagnosis is made
The MCH value is measured from a blood sample, usually as part of a CBC. The test is simple for the patient, though the interpretation can be detailed. A doctor may look at the full red blood cell profile, white blood cell count, platelet count, and any flags from the laboratory before deciding whether more testing is needed.
If MCH is low or high, the next tests may depend on the suspected cause. Common follow-up studies include ferritin and iron panels, vitamin B12, folate, reticulocyte count, and sometimes tests for inflammation, thyroid function, liver function, or blood loss. In some cases, a peripheral blood smear helps show the shape and size of red blood cells more clearly.
Diagnosis is not a single-number process. A well-organized doctor visit will usually ask about symptoms, diet, bleeding history, medications, alcohol intake, digestive problems, and any previous anemia treatment. Treatment options
Treatment depends on the reason behind the abnormal MCH, not the MCH number itself. If iron deficiency is found, the doctor may recommend dietary changes and iron replacement, while also investigating why the deficiency developed in the first place. If a vitamin B12 or folate deficiency is identified, treatment focuses on replacing the missing nutrient and addressing absorption problems or dietary gaps.
When the issue is related to blood loss, the priority is to identify and manage the source. When chronic disease, thyroid disease, liver disease, or a bone marrow problem is suspected, treatment is tailored to the underlying condition and may involve a specialist. In some cases, no direct treatment is needed because the result is only mildly outside the range and the rest of the evaluation is reassuring.
Patients should avoid starting supplements on their own before discussing results with a clinician, especially if the cause of the abnormality is not yet known. Self-treatment can blur the lab picture and delay the correct diagnosis. A physician can recommend the most appropriate plan and decide whether repeat testing is needed after treatment begins.
Prevention and self-care
Not every MCH change can be prevented, but good general health habits can support normal blood production. A balanced diet that includes iron-rich foods, vitamin B12 sources, folate-rich vegetables and legumes, and adequate protein is a practical starting point. Hydration, rest, and adherence to chronic disease treatment plans also matter because overall health affects blood results.
For people with a known tendency toward anemia or nutrient deficiency, consistency is especially helpful. Following up on recommended laboratory checks, taking prescribed supplements as directed, and reporting recurring symptoms early can prevent small issues from becoming long-standing ones. Patients with heavy menstrual bleeding, digestive symptoms, or dietary restrictions may need a more tailored plan.

When to see a doctor
A doctor should review an abnormal MCH when it is new, persistent, or accompanied by symptoms. Even a mild change may deserve attention if there is fatigue, dizziness, shortness of breath, paleness, chest discomfort, a rapid heartbeat, or ongoing bleeding. The goal is not to alarm patients but to identify the reason early and clearly.
Medical review is also sensible if someone has a known nutrient deficiency, a chronic illness, a recent change in diet, or a history of stomach or intestinal problems that could affect absorption. Frequently asked questions
What does MCH mean on a blood test?
MCH stands for mean corpuscular hemoglobin. It measures the average amount of hemoglobin in each red blood cell and is usually reported as part of a CBC. Doctors use it to help evaluate patterns that may point toward anemia or related blood issues.
Is a low MCH always anemia?
No, a low MCH is not the same as a diagnosis of anemia. It can be one clue that red blood cells are carrying less hemoglobin than expected, but the full CBC and other tests are needed to understand the cause. Some people may have a low MCH before anemia is clearly present.
What can cause a high MCH?
A high MCH is often seen when red blood cells are larger than usual, such as in vitamin B12 or folate deficiency. It can also be influenced by liver disease, alcohol use, certain medications, or bone marrow conditions. The meaning depends on the rest of the blood count and the person’s history.
Do I need to fast before an MCH blood test?
The MCH value is part of a routine blood count and usually does not require fasting. If other blood tests are ordered at the same time, the doctor or laboratory may give different instructions. It is always best to follow the specific preparation advice provided for the full test panel.
Can diet improve an abnormal MCH?
Diet can help when the underlying issue is related to iron, vitamin B12, or folate intake, but the right approach depends on the cause. A doctor should confirm the reason before supplements are started, especially if there may be blood loss or another medical problem. Targeted treatment is more effective than guessing.
When should someone worry about an abnormal MCH?
An abnormal MCH should be reviewed, but it is not automatically an emergency. It becomes more important when it comes with symptoms such as fatigue, shortness of breath, dizziness, paleness, or bleeding. A clinician can decide whether additional testing or treatment is needed.
